Learn to build a digital illustrated story with the three-act structure and assemble your first picturebook
Delve into the world of storytelling with Renata, who guides you through writing, illustrating, and designing your first picturebook. Explore how visual and verbal language can playfully interact to enhance your narrative. Then digitize your story with Photoshop and InDesign before assembling your first picturebook.
